Java随机分配randomdata
在Java编程中,有时候我们需要生成一些随机数据,用来进行测试、模拟场景或者其他目的。为了实现这个需求,我们可以借助Java提供的随机数生成器来随机分配数据。本文将介绍如何在Java中随机分配randomdata,并给出相应的代码示例。
随机数生成器
Java中提供了java.util.Random
类来生成随机数。这个类可以通过nextInt()
方法来生成一个随机的整数,也可以通过nextDouble()
方法来生成一个随机的双精度浮点数。我们可以利用这个类生成随机数据,并进行相应的分配。
随机分配randomdata
下面是一个简单的示例,演示了如何在Java中随机分配randomdata:
import java.util.Random;
public class RandomDataGenerator {
public static void main(String[] args) {
Random random = new Random();
int[] data = new int[10];
for (int i = 0; i < 10; i++) {
data[i] = random.nextInt(100);
}
for (int i = 0; i < 10; i++) {
System.out.println("Random data " + i + ": " + data[i]);
}
}
}
在这个示例中,我们首先创建了一个Random
对象random
,然后生成了一个长度为10的整数数组data
。接着使用nextInt(100)
方法生成一个0到99之间的随机整数,并将其赋值给数组中的每个元素。最后,我们遍历数组并打印出每个随机数。
序列图
下面是一个使用mermaid语法表示的序列图,展示了上述代码的执行流程:
sequenceDiagram
participant User
participant RandomDataGenerator
User->>RandomDataGenerator: 启动程序
RandomDataGenerator->>RandomDataGenerator: 创建Random对象
RandomDataGenerator->>RandomDataGenerator: 生成随机数并分配数据
RandomDataGenerator->>RandomDataGenerator: 打印随机数据
RandomDataGenerator->>User: 完成程序执行
结语
通过这篇文章,我们了解了如何在Java中随机分配randomdata。通过使用java.util.Random
类,我们可以轻松地生成随机数据,并将其分配到数组或其他数据结构中。这对于测试、模拟和其他一些应用场景来说非常有用。希望本文能够帮助读者更好地理解Java中的随机数据生成。